False fire alarm at multi-family building in St. Charles, St Charles IL


A fire alarm was activated at a three-story multi-family building near Lakeside Drive in St. Charles. Responding units arrived but later determined the alarm was a system trouble, not an actual fire. The incoming units were cancelled.
